Greek-English Dictionary

Strongs: G3123
Greek: μᾶλλον
Transliteration: mallon
Pronunciation: mal'-lon
Part of Speech: Adverb
Bible Usage: + better X-(idiom) far (the) more (and more) (so) much (the more) rather.
Definition:  

(adverb) more (in a greater degree) or rather

1. more, to a greater degree, rather

a. much, by far

b. rather, sooner

c. more willingly, more readily, sooner
